  1. I am a newb first of all so forgive me if this is a really dumb problem. So, i have this OGM i was trying to encode to work on my DVD player, and i converted all the files, and i think i have every base covered. So i load it up in TMPgenc DVD author and i get an error! Its says that i cannot use 23 FPS on an NTSC compliant DVD player and must convert them to 29 FPS. I know that changing the famerate of a video will throw it out of sync with the audio. so is there any way to get a 23 FPS video onto a DVD without losing audio syncing? thank you in advance.

    Use pulldown.exe with gui,it will apply the 3:2 pulldown flag without re-encoding so tda will accept it as 29.97 fps.The audio will stay in sync.
